Edge of Darkness (a.k.a. Norway in Revolt) is a 1943 World War II film directed by Lewis Milestone that features Errol Flynn, Ann Sheridan, and Walter Huston. The feature is based on a script written by Robert Rossen which was adapted from the 1942 novel The Edge of Darkness by William Woods.
Edge of Darkness: Directed by Lewis Milestone. With Errol Flynn, Ann Sheridan, Walter Huston, Nancy Coleman. After two years under German rule, a small Norwegian fishing village rises up and revolts against the occupying Nazis.
